How to Pull off the Boyfriend Shirt Look

I like to dress outside the box, and I do so whenever I get the chance. Dressing conventionally every day would be very boring for me, so I like to have an unconventional style, a style that I would see no one else wearing. The place where I experiment and play with my outfits is, believe it or not, my office. My workplace is my runway, and one of the reasons why I love my job (even though my day time job is unrelated to writing and fashion) is the fact that our company dress code is casual attire which gives us quite a lot of dressing freedom, and this is how I bring my passion for fashion into my day time job on a daily basis, which gives me one more reason to love my job.

One of the unconventional outfits that I wore to work was to wear a skirt as a top, and I did so with several of my skirts, and I combined them with a blazer and pants or jeans. Do you think anyone noticed that my top was actually not a top, but a skirt? Nope, nobody noticed. :) Another unconventional outfit of mine was to wear dresses as skirts, combined with sweaters, so the dress was not even visible as a dress under the sweater, but it created the illusion of a skirt, and I pulled it off as a skirt. I wore such an outfit at the beginning of this week, a dress combined with a sweater that passed on as a skirt. Another way to wear a dress as a skirt is to combine it with a shirt and a skinny belt. What you need to make this work is to make sure that the upper part of the dress is not visible under the shirt or the sweater, and also the dress must be made of a light material, to avoid any bulgy effect under the shirt or the sweater.

Another unconventional outfit that I wore to work was denim shorts with a long black blazer, opac burgundy tights and high heels (5 inches platforms). Shorts aren't exactly allowed in my office, but I managed to pull it off, thanks to the long blazer that balanced the whole outfit which made my shorts look like a skirt rather than actual shorts. A newer colleague of mine saw me wearing my denim shorts on that day (it was a Friday, and everybody in my company tends to wear jeans on Fridays), and surprised, she asked me: "Are we allowed to wear shorts at work?" "Nope, we're not, I'm breaking the rules today. :)". Either the HR team didn't see me on that day, or they saw me but they didn't dislike my outfit -- whatever the case, I didn't get any negative feedback regarding my outfit in the office on that Friday, somehow frivolous (and I'll be the first one to admit that) for our dress code.

My favorite unconventional outfit is the boyfriend shirt look, which involves an actual boyfriend shirt. Every now and again I feel attracted by the right side of my walk-in closet and I let myslef inspired by my husband's wardrobe; case in point, his shirts. I pulled it off twice, at work -- once I did it combined with a black pencil skirt, and another time with flared jeans.

In today's story, I will showcase the boyfriend shirt look in combination with flared jeans, and I hope it will inspire you to try it on! :)

When you want to pull off the boyfriend shirt look with an actual men's shirt, the most important thing is to keep the whole look balanced, that is keep the shirt as the only androginous element of your outfit, while the rest of it should be feminine, and that's because you want to be inspired by your boyfriend's (or husband's) wardrobe, and not look like him.

Flared jeans are a great way to achieve that balance, but also accessories are important. The way how I chose to make the whole boyfriend shirt look feminine, is to pile up necklaces (I love layered jewelry style), and to cinch my waist with a leopard belt. Also, I wore leopard platform ankle boots and a clutch. High heels are very important when pulling off an unconventional outfit, or an outfit inspired by men's wardrobe, never underestimate what a pair of high heels can do.
